In present work a new setup for in situ studies of molecular self-assembling process for fabrication of ion-conducting membranes for “green” fuel cells was developed. Due to compactness, this unique setup can be used on the synchrotron beamlines. The GISAXS and optical microscopy data have shown the effectiveness of the control of molecular architecture by impact of high temperature, UV-irradiation and solvent vapors.

Large size diffusion limited aggregates (DLA) in ion conducting polymeric system, PEO:NH 4 I (+ Al 2 O 3), have been obtained. The species responsible for the formation of the DLA have been identified as [Formula: see text] by fluorescence studies. It is also shown that if I 2 gets formed (instead of [Formula: see text] aggregates) at selected regions, then "strain field" is established which forbids further approach of ionic random walkers and hence no fractals grow around these regions.
